If USB access does not work, what will work for sure is to take the microsd card out of the DR (unscrew at the back, be careful when re-inserting not to insert the card under the actual slot), and access it via a card reader, (usual SD card readers will do if you have a suitable adapter piece)
Alternatively, if you do not have a card reader, insert another (preferably empty) microsd card into the reader and try if it boots all the way, after that you can format the new card in settings, and disable thumbnails generation. (you might even try if the old card now works).
